Transaction 6500899955978672ed5041a0da1f510a3dde65012a8c2a6fe9978ba39efe8cac
1 Input
1 Output
-
6500899955978672ed5041a0da1f510a3dde65012a8c2a6fe9978ba39efe8cac:0
- value
- 880044
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89d7a25ff20ee4add03835d1d740b9f194fbcc6d OP_EQUAL
- address
- 3EFrpMeF198hgwuwZEwdf7q24AMGonRPpz